A few red flags (stuff to avoid subsequently the plague)
Alright, mini-rant. Some of these so-called working IG Reels downloaders that work are straight-up scams. Heres what to look out for:
Login Required: Nope. Dont. Never. A legit IG Reels downloader that works will not question for your Insta login. Thats phishing, my dude.
Too Many Ads: I acquire it. Gotta monetize. But subsequently I click Download and six tabs open, somethings off.
No HTTPS: If the URL doesnt have that little padlock? Run.
Fake Download Buttons: perpetual trick. Theres in the manner of five Download buttons and only one actually does something. Its following Minesweeper, but for your privacy.
